Make a natural soap at home (DIY)


Making soap at home can be a fun and rewarding experience. Here is a basic recipe and steps for making soap at home:


Ingredients:


  • 2 cups of coconut oil

  • 2 cups of olive oil
  • 2 cups of distilled water
  • 1 cup of lye (sodium hydroxide)



Tools:


  • Stainless steel pot
  • Thermometer
  • Plastic or silicone mold
  • Safety goggles
  • Rubber gloves
  • Long-sleeved shirt
  • Wooden spoon

Steps:


  1. Put on your safety gear: goggles, gloves, and a long-sleeved shirt to protect yourself from the lye.
  2. In a stainless steel pot, heat the coconut oil and olive oil on low heat until they are melted.
  3. In another container, carefully mix the lye and distilled water. It will get hot and release fumes, so be sure to do this in a well-ventilated area.
  4. Let the lye mixture cool to room temperature, then add it to the pot of melted oils. Stir the mixture with a wooden spoon until it thickens and reaches trace, which is when the mixture leaves a visible trail when you lift the spoon.
  5. Pour the mixture into a plastic or silicone mold, tap it on a flat surface to remove air bubbles, and cover it with a towel or plastic wrap.
  6. Let the soap cure for 4-6 weeks in a cool, dry place. During this time, the soap will harden and the lye will neutralize, making it safe to use.
  7. After the curing period, remove the soap from the mold and cut it into bars.
  8. That's it! This recipe makes a basic, unscented soap, but you can experiment with adding scents, colors, and other ingredients to customize your soap. However, be sure to research the properties and safe usage of any ingredients you plan to add to your soap.
